Prázdniny v Provence Ending Explained: A trio of rock-and-roll musicians arrives in the south of France for a sun-drenched summer of debauched fun and romance in this breezy comedy. Directed by Vladimír Michálek, this 2016 comedy film stars Kryštof Hádek (Filip Stárka), alongside Vojtěch Kotek as Matěj Novotný, Jakub Prachař as David Merta, Denisa Pfauserová as Sofie.
